Halfway between Biloela and Monto Queensland, on the Burnett Highway, Cania Gorge National Park is a landscape carved out of sandstone by water. It is 3000 hectares of sandstone rock faces, towering gums, open woodland and fern fringed secluded pools. At 135 million years old, Mossman Gorge forms part of the oldest surviving rainforest in Australia and the world.  From Mossman, the world heritage listed Daintree Rainforest begins it’s northward journey to Cape Tribulation and a rendezvous with Australia’s Great Barrier Reef.
